初級java怎么提高自己的能力 初級Java
隨著互聯網行業(yè)的蓬勃發(fā)展,Java作為一種廣泛應用的編程語言,對于初級開發(fā)者來說具有很大的發(fā)展?jié)摿褪袌鲂枨?。然而,想要在競爭激烈的Java開發(fā)領域中脫穎而出,并提升自身的技能水平,需要付出努力和持續(xù)
隨著互聯網行業(yè)的蓬勃發(fā)展,Java作為一種廣泛應用的編程語言,對于初級開發(fā)者來說具有很大的發(fā)展?jié)摿褪袌鲂枨?。然而,想要在競爭激烈的Java開發(fā)領域中脫穎而出,并提升自身的技能水平,需要付出努力和持續(xù)學習。本文將詳細介紹如何通過學習方法、實踐編程和積累經驗等方式來提升初級Java開發(fā)者的能力。
一、選擇合適的學習方法
學習方法是提升技能的基石,一個高效的學習方法可以事半功倍。針對初級Java開發(fā)者,以下幾種學習方法值得嘗試:
1. 學習教材和視頻教程:選擇一本深入易懂的Java教材、或者觀看優(yōu)質的Java視頻教程,系統(tǒng)地學習Java的基礎知識和常用技術。
2. 參加培訓班或在線課程:報名參加有資深講師授課的Java培訓班,或者選取優(yōu)質的在線課程進行學習,通過專業(yè)指導和實踐案例,提升編程能力和問題解決能力。
3. 參與開源項目:積極參與開源項目的開發(fā)過程,與其他開發(fā)者合作,學習別人的代碼并分享自己的經驗,這樣可以快速提高編程技巧和團隊協(xié)作能力。
二、實踐編程并完成項目
學以致用是提升Java技能的重要途徑之一。通過實踐編程,可以將理論知識應用于實際項目中,鍛煉自身的問題解決能力和編程實踐經驗。
1. 基于實際需求,選取一個小型的Java項目進行實踐,比如開發(fā)一個簡單的學生管理系統(tǒng)或者一個論壇網站。
2. 在項目過程中,遇到問題時不要束手無策,可以通過查閱文檔、搜索引擎、論壇等方式尋找解決方案。
3. 與其他開發(fā)者交流和討論,分享自己的項目經驗和遇到的困難,互相啟發(fā)和幫助。
4. 在實踐過程中要注重代碼的規(guī)范和優(yōu)化,學習使用調試工具,掌握常用的調試技巧。
三、積累經驗和深入研究
除了學習和實踐,積累經驗和深入研究也是提升Java技能的關鍵。
1. 閱讀優(yōu)秀的Java開源項目代碼,學習其設計思路和優(yōu)秀的編程風格。
2. 多參與技術社區(qū)的討論,關注最新的技術動態(tài)和行業(yè)趨勢,積極回答問題和分享自己的見解。
3. 定期總結和復習已學知識,建立自己的技術文檔庫,方便日后查閱和回顧。
4. 學習一些與Java相關的其他技術,比如數據庫、分布式系統(tǒng)等,拓寬自己的技術視野。
總結:
通過選擇合適的學習方法、實踐編程并完成項目,以及積累經驗和深入研究Java技術,初級Java開發(fā)者可以不斷提升自身的技能水平。然而,這個過程是漫長且需要持續(xù)的,需要堅持不懈地學習和實踐才能取得顯著的進步。相信只要你付出足夠的努力和時間,就一定能夠成為一名優(yōu)秀的Java開發(fā)者!